Nazar Raoof, MD
Nazar Raoof, MD grew up in Old Brookville, NY. He graduated summa cum laude from Vassar College in Poughkeepsie, NY, earning honors in Biochemistry and election to the Phi Beta Kappa honor society. He completed his medical school training at the Mount Sinai School of Medicine in NYC in 2003. He finished his Internal Medicine Internship and Residency at UMDNJ-Robert Wood Johnson University Hospital (RWJUH). He stayed at RWJUH to complete his Fellowship in Infectious Diseases.
Dr. Raoof is Board Certified in Internal Medicine and Infectious Diseases. He is a member of the Infectious Disease Society of America and American College of Physicians.
Currently, he serves as a consultant in Infectious Diseases at Raritan Bay Medical Center in Perth Amboy, NJ and Old Bridge, NJ.
